ARALDITE® DY 3602

ARALDITE® DY 3602 is a difunctional reactive diluent for epoxy resins.

Applications
Product Applications

May be mixed with unmodified bisphenol-A or bisphenol-A/F epoxy resins to formulate low-viscosity epoxy resins for solvent-free coatings, flooring screeds and mastics.

Properties

Reactive diluents have generally low viscosity due to their low molecular weight; their vapor pressure is higher than most of standard epoxy resins. ARALDITE® DY 3602 combines a low vapor pressure with a good diluting effect. The use of ARALDITE® DY 3602 in surface technologies has the following effects, according to the amount included:

  • Lower viscosity
  • Slightly less reactivity
  • An reduction in resistance to acids
  • A reduction in resistance to solvents and ammonia

Storage & Handling

Storage Condition

ARALDITE® DY 3602 should be stored in a dry place, preferably in the sealed original container, at temperatures between 2 and 40 °C. The product should not be stored exposed to direct sunlight.
